The Love That We Once Knew
by Mitchell E. Marlow, Sr.

Sunday, October 14, 2012
Not rated by the Author.
Share   Print  Save   Become a Fan


A sad poem of a lost love from long ago.

Paint me a picture,
Of the love that we once knew,
Gently mixing colours warm,
That make up me and you.

Starting with a background,
We knew from way back when,
Let us paint a sunrise,
A good place to begin.

A silhouette of trees,
With roots that will grow deep,
Of oaks, and pines, and weeping willow,
And oft' times it will weep.

As you paint with gentleness,
Remembering patience too,
Soon the painting is complete,
Of the love that we once knew.
